Hello, I am interested in displaying my wall art collection of 10-20 pieces at the galery. My goal is to sell. How do I go about it? What are cost for time and space. What percentage of the sale belongs to me? Thank you!

Neli Petkova | Mar 5, 2022
Blue Line Arts | Mar 5, 2022

Hi Neli, Thank you for reaching out about this. 10-20 works is a good body of work. I encourage you to submit your work to our call for artists opportunities listed on our website: https://www.bluelinearts.org/call-to-artists most of the opportunities are free when you become an artist member for the low price of $75 for the year starting the day you join and our artist members receive 60% commission on any sales. To learn more and become a member, please visit: https://www.bluelinearts.org/membership If you have any other questions, you are welcome to give us a call at the gallery: 916-783-4117 Thank you, Blue Line Arts
